
转而使用OpenCV或NumPy提供的内置函数,它们通常用C/C++实现,效率极高。 指针接收器 (Pointer Receiver):方法接收的是指向结构体实例的指针。 对于字符串类型,通常是检查其是否为空字符串("")。 “No CMAKE_CXX_COMPILER could be found...

选择项目存放目录: 打开终端或命令行工具,进入你希望存放项目的目录。 核心在于 `gomaxprocs` 配置,它控制 go 运行时可使用的操作系统线程数。 import numpy as np data_1d = np.array([1, 2, 3]) # 方法一:使用 np.array() 和嵌...

使用 <cstdlib> 中的 rand()(旧式方法) 这是C语言沿用下来的方法,简单但不推荐用于高质量随机场景。 错误处理: 在生产环境中,应加入适当的错误处理机制,例如检查 load() 或 loadXML() 的返回值,以及对 getElementsByTagName() 返回的...

您需要在 build 方法中获取邮件内容和文件路径,然后使用 Storage facade 来解析文件的完整物理路径,并将其传递给 attach 方法。 按业务域划分包,避免技术层划分导致的代码混杂。 理解这些概念将帮助你编写更健壮、更易于维护的 PHP 代码。 通过分离 RPC 和 HTTP 健康...

总结 通过更换字体来源和清理旧字体缓存,可以有效解决TCPDF自定义字体显示乱码的问题。 这意味着用户可以选择不填写该字段。 在我看来,选择哪种方法,往往取决于你对性能、代码可读性、是否需要修改原字符串以及项目依赖的综合考量。 3. 构建和添加查询参数 查询参数通过url.Values类型来管理,它...

运行时多态(动态多态) 运行时多态是C++中最常见的多态形式,依赖于基类指针或引用调用虚函数,在程序运行时确定具体调用哪个派生类的函数。 用PHP递归函数绘制分形图形,虽然PHP不是专为图形处理设计的语言,但结合GD库和递归思想,完全可以生成有趣的分形图案,比如科赫雪花、谢尔宾斯基三角形或分形树。 ...

但对于命令行工具来说,只需要重启命令行窗口即可。 然而,当qlabel用于播放动态图像(qmovie,例如gif文件)时,情况变得复杂。 隐式作用域绑定: 对于严格的父子关系(例如 license 必须属于特定的 beat),可以进一步使用隐式作用域绑定(Scoped Bindings),它会在父模...

package main import ( "fmt" "reflect" ) func ValidateRequired[T any](obj T) []string { var errors []string v := reflect.ValueOf(obj) t := reflect.Type...

步骤包括: 小文AI论文 轻松解决论文写作难题,AI论文助您一键完成,仅需一杯咖啡时间,即可轻松问鼎学术高峰! 准备 SQL 查询: 构建包含 WHERE id IN (...) 结构的 SQL 查询语句。 4. 自定义替换表加密 可以定义一个字符映射表,将原始字符替换成其他符号。 std::fun...

延迟加锁(std::defer_lock): 构造时可以不立即加锁,后续再手动调用lock()。 优化:对IR进行各种优化。 两者均遵循键唯一性,但 emplace 在插入重型对象时性能更优,多数场景推荐 emplace。 选择哪种取决于你的使用场景:脚本自动化推荐Python+lxml,人工审查用...